[PATCH v5] ceph: bound encrypted snapshot suffix formatting

ceph_encode_encrypted_dname() base64-encodes the encrypted snapshot
name into the caller buffer and then, for long snapshot names, appends
_<ino> with sprintf(p + elen, ...).

Some callers only provide NAME_MAX bytes. For long snapshot names, a
large inode suffix can push the final encoded name past NAME_MAX even
though the encrypted prefix stayed within the documented 240-byte
budget.

Format the suffix into a small local buffer first and reject names whose
suffix would exceed the caller's NAME_MAX output buffer.

Changes since v4:
- rebase on current linux/master
- keep the inode suffix format as %llu after the treewide i_ino type
  change

Changes since v3:
- reject `elen > 240` explicitly instead of relying only on the earlier
  `WARN_ON()`
- rewrite the NAME_MAX bound check in terms of the final total length
  instead of `NAME_MAX - prefix_len - elen`
